|  | Registered User | | Join Date: Oct 2001 Location: Niagara Falls, ON, Canada | | | Just buy a 4 string set and a C string single to match. You might need to get a new nut, but I'm getting away without it right now. |

| | Registered User | | Join Date: Dec 2007 Location: NY, NY | | | Thats a bad idea, paper nuts...
Get a 5 banger, buy some D'Addario 4 string sets, buy some high C strings, and then get a set up. Voila.
I'm sure there are other brands than D'Addario, but they're the only ones I know of off the top of my head
